If you want to hear some great ACW era music, I highly recommend the 2nd South Carolina String Band. They have about four CD's out and each of them is a gem. Not for the politically correct, as they capture the essence of the period with some post-war songs as well. They also perform at most major eastern ACW reenactments, so if you attend one, follow the music to them in the sutler area. Jeff Mathes Captain Sharpshooter Brigade 1st Division III Corps, AoA |
